Handover Note — Dirs. Malla Crevin to Otto Vanshear

Sales leads: we have locked the hedge on the Torland krona exposure for the Brindlecote contract. Forward cover runs twelve months at the rate agreed last Thursday. Do not quote in krona beyond that window without clearance. Unhedged tail on the Quelsa deal stays open deliberately; margin buffer covers it. Otto owns counterparty reviews from Monday. Pricing sheets update Friday. Questions go through Otto, not treasury directly. Context for the decision follows below.

confidential, kagup-bafog: Fraaxax Group is in early talks to buy Soroxox Group for about $343.8 million. The Olidor launch date is June 14, and nothing goes to the press before then. Legal wants the Aldmirek Logistics term sheet signed before July 23.

Project Larchgate, our internal workflow consolidation effort at Veltrona Systems, remains behind schedule by approximately eight weeks. The delay stems from extended integration testing and the reassignment of two engineers to the Oakhaven release. Budget impact is contained within the existing contingency. Revised milestones put completion in early Q1, with a checkpoint review in November. The steering group considers the plan achievable. The broader strategic implications are summarised in the note below.

internal memo for kawip-kawef: Gilaxax Logistics is in early talks to buy Olimirax Partners for about $65.1 million. The Lamael launch date is March 4, and nothing goes to the press before then. Legal wants the Ralirox Partners term sheet withdrawn before November 7.

Handover — vendored fonts (from Priya to Oskar, for the release manager)

All third-party typefaces for Brightleaf are now vendored under `assets/fonts/` with license files alongside each family; nothing is fetched at build time anymore. The checksum manifest is regenerated on every release tag, so verify it before signing. The font pipeline reads the configuration reproduced below.

settings of fafog-haduf:
ZORIX_PIN=4648
ZORIX_METRICS_HOST=metrics.zorix.paliqsys.corp
ZORIX_LOG_LEVEL=info
ZORIX_TENANT=druix